
kakaobrain/trident
🏗️ फ्रेमवर्कkakaobrain
OpenAI के Triton का उपयोग करके मशीन लर्निंग अनुप्रयोगों को गति देने वाली एक उच्च-प्रदर्शन लाइब्रेरी।
Trident एक ओपन-सोर्स लाइब्रेरी है जिसे डीप लर्निंग रिसर्च और प्रोडक्शन में आने वाली परफॉरमेंस बाधाओं को दूर करने के लिए बनाया गया है। अत्यधिक कुशल GPU कोड लिखने के लिए Triton का उपयोग करके, Trident डेवलपर्स को मानक PyTorch ऑपरेटरों की सीमाओं को पार करने की अनुमति देती है। यह कस्टम कर्नेल को परिभाषित करने के लिए एक संरचित वातावरण प्रदान करती है जो विशिष्ट हार्डवेयर आर्किटेक्चर के लिए स्वचालित रूप से अनुकूलित होते हैं। इसकी मुख्य विशेषताओं में एक मॉड्यूलर डिज़ाइन शामिल है जो मौजूदा PyTorch पाइपलाइनों के साथ सहजता से एकीकृत होता है, उन्नत मेमोरी प्रबंधन के लिए समर्थन, और कंप्यूट-गहन कार्यों में विलंबता (latency) को कम करने पर ध्यान केंद्रित करना शामिल है। चाहे आप बड़े पैमाने के ट्रांसफार्मर मॉडल पर काम कर रहे हों या कस्टम एक्टिवेशन फ़ंक्शंस पर, Trident बिना रॉ CUDA कोड लिखने की जटिलता के, लगभग नेटिव GPU प्रदर्शन प्राप्त करने के लिए आवश्यक एब्स्ट्रैक्शन प्रदान करती है।
💡मुख्य बातें
- ├─Triton-आधारित कर्नेल ऑप्टिमाइज़ेशन
- ├─सहज PyTorch एकीकरण
- └─कस्टम GPU ऑपरेटर त्वरण
🎯के लिए
- ├─मशीन लर्निंग इंजीनियर
- └─GPU परफॉरमेंस शोधकर्ता